Transaction 8cbb88ef084579d57a71894dd6bcefccddb16ab13f61d35d3a06b65e69eb2105
3 Input
2 Outputs
- 8cbb88ef084579d57a71894dd6bcefccddb16ab13f61d35d3a06b65e69eb2105:0
- 8cbb88ef084579d57a71894dd6bcefccddb16ab13f61d35d3a06b65e69eb2105:1
value 412462
address 1HLdQpdhdQ5MQgyWA7iHrrXUuefiohrgL9
value 25589087
address 13Ada3WpMvcTRynfHES1naTF2u3D5KoAYP